Ive seen references to Pluto 1.0.x and 1.1x. What are versions 1.x used for?
Pluto 1.0.x is based off of the code base which was originally donated to the ASF by IBM. The first release candidate in this series was published on October 8, 2004. Pluto 1.0.x is only maintained for bug fixes. Pluto 1.0.1 is the portlet container embedded in all Jetspeed release up until version 2.2.0. From version 2.2.0 onward, Jetspeed embeds Pluto 2.0.x. The 1.1.x series is a refactoring/rewrite of Pluto 1.0.x. It’s entire purpose is to simplify the container and make it easier for both Portlet Developers and Portal Developers looking to embed Pluto into their portal to use Pluto. Now that Pluto 2.0.0 has been released, our team highly recommends that you migrate to it. Pluto 1.0.x development has been stagnant for some time and there are no plans to support it in the future.
